Spartak (Ukrainian: Спартак; Russian: Спартак) is a village in Yasynuvata urban hromada, Donetsk Raion (district in Donetsk Oblast of Ukraine, at about 20 km NNW from the centre of Donetsk city. Spartak borders from south-west with the Donetsk airfield.

From 1986 until 2003 the village was connected to the city Avdiivka by a tram line.[2]
The War in Donbass, that started in mid-April 2014, has brought along both civilian and military casualties.[3] Since then, the Spartak has been under the occupation of the Russian Donetsk People's Republic.
